See this post for my settings. Instead of using 9x445fsb use 8x500fsb. Set freq latch to auto and mem multi to 3.2B. Of course you will/might have to tweak some of your voltages and refs as well, but the performance increase is worth it.

I recetly found out that I've actually got a bent pin on my UD3P which isn't raised enough to make proper contact. It was one of the many 'vcc' pins on the pinout (top right pin in the socket), and I wondered if this might be why I started getting weird stability issues. I did a little mod by 'glooping' a ball of condictive pen ink onto the corner of the CPU and hooking it up to the affected pin. This has actually helped, and am now able to use much lower VTT, plus tuning the CPU ref seems more effective too.
